III. Most Common Mobile Security Threats
Cellphones may be small, but the risks they bring are large. Some of the most frequent risk contents in India are as follows: –
Malware and Ransomware
Malicious apps or downloads that steal your data or lock your phone and demand money before they release it.
Phishing and Social Engineering
False SMS or WhatsApp messages, requesting OTPs, bank and/or personal information.
Unsecured Wi-Fi Networks
Hackers can intercept data in unprotected free Wi-Fi at cafes or airports.
App Vulnerabilities
Attackers just need a loophole in third-party or coded apps.
Physical Threats
Stolen or lost hardware can also offer criminals a direct path into your files.

VI. How to Protect Yourself: Double Down
You can follow the below Individual Best Practices:
- Use strong and different passwords, or, better yet, biometric locks.
- Only install apps from reputable app stores.
- Regularly update OS and apps.
- Never use public Wi-Fi without a VPN.
- Business Strategies
- Deploy MDM or EMM software.
- Establish clear mobile security policies.
- Regularly train employees about phishing and scams.
- Use Mobile Threat Defense (MTD) solutions.

What’s the Future of Mobile Security in Cyber Security?
Mobile security of the future is going to be more difficult, but also more interesting, particularly in India’s rapidly evolving digital ecosystem. With phones becoming the core of payments, health care, e-learning, and work collaboration, the attack surface is getting even bigger.
Among the biggest changes is the spread of 5G networks. The new 5G technology provides faster speeds and access to real-time applications, but it also introduces larger, more complex networks to be attacked by cybercriminals. Businesses need to have beefier cloud network security and zero-trust models in place so they can secure the data that’s flowing across those high-speed connections.
Another pertinent issue is the emergence of Internet of Things (IoT) devices. From wearable fitness devices to smart home systems that are connected to smartphones, every connected device opens up a new potential entry point for hackers. Protecting these demands a system wide strategy which combines protection on the device as well as strong mobile device security in network security infrastructure.
AI (Artificial Intelligence) and ML (Machine Learning) will gain more prominence. AI-based systems can spot anomalies, like unauthorized logins or suspicious app activities in real-time, and they provide proactive defense. And McKinsey research indicates that AI-enhanced cyber security can shorten breach detection time by as much as 90 percent, demonstrating the technology’s usefulness in defending mobile networks of the future.
